Plurilock Security (CVE:PLUR) Stock Price Down 10.7% – Should You Sell?

Plurilock Security Inc. (CVE:PLURGet Free Report)’s share price dropped 10.7% during trading on Thursday . The stock traded as low as C$0.12 and last traded at C$0.12. Approximately 180,634 shares were traded during mid-day trading, an increase of 24% from the average daily volume of 146,226 shares. The stock had previously closed at C$0.14.

Plurilock Security Price Performance

The stock has a fifty day moving average of C$0.12 and a 200 day moving average of C$0.12. The firm has a market capitalization of C$14.05 million, a P/E ratio of -2.08 and a beta of 3.30.

About Plurilock Security

Plurilock Security Inc operates an identity-centric cybersecurity company in the United States, India, and Canada. The company operates in two divisions, Technology and Solutions. It offers Plurilock DEFEND, Plurilock DEFEND, an enterprise continuous authentication platform that confirms user identity or alerts security teams to detected compromises in real time; Plurilock AI DLP that helps in data loss prevention and cloud security; and Plurilock AI Cloud that provides access management, email data security, and compliance for cloud environments.
